The baby name Sudh is a Unisex name , 1 syllables long and is pronounced /sudh/ or /sud̪h/ (approx. "soodh" or "sudh").
Sudh is Hindi, Sanskrit in Origin.
Sudh is a short Indo‑Aryan given name with Sanskrit roots. As a lexical item, sudhā denotes “nectar, ambrosia,” while the related Sanskrit śuddha (shuddh) means “pure; undefiled.” In modern Hindi, sudh also carries the sense of “awareness” or “remembrance,” familiar from the phrase sudh‑budh. Taken together, the name is interpreted as purity, life‑giving sweetness, or clear awareness, making it appealing for its virtuous and luminous overtones. It is used chiefly in India and Nepal and occasionally across the South Asian diaspora.
As a forename, Sudh often began as a clipped form of longer Sanskritic names - Sudhanshu, Sudhir, Sudhakar - and came to be adopted independently in the late 20th century. Predominantly masculine but usable as unisex, it appears in spellings Sudh, Soodh, or Shudh/Shuddh (reflecting regional transliteration). Related names include Sudha (feminine), Sudhir, Sudhakar, Sudhanshu, and Shuddha.
